Do electric fireplaces need venting through the wall in Colorado?

No, electric fireplaces do not require traditional venting through the wall, which is a significant advantage in Colorado. They generate heat through electrical resistance and do not produce combustion byproducts, simplifying installation and allowing for greater placement flexibility within your home.
